Botanical name: Tolmiea menziesii 'Taff's Gold'

Other names: Pick-a-back plant 'Taff's Gold', Mother of thousands 'Taff's Gold', Piggy back plant 'Taff's Gold', Youth on age 'Taff's Gold'


Sign up for your FREE ACCOUNT today or login to add this plant to your plants list


Genus: Tolmiea

Variety or cultivar: 'Taff's Gold' _ 'Taff's Gold' is a small semi-evergreen perennial. It has rough, hairy, ivy-shaped leaves that are mottled cream and green. In spirng, it bears spikes of tiny, nodding, greenish, tubular flowers. Its common names refer to the plantlets that develop where the leaves join the stem of the plant.

Tolmiea menziesii 'Taff's Gold' is: Semi evergreen

Flower: Pale-green in Spring

Foliage: Green, Cream in All seasons

Habit: Mat Forming

Awards: RHS AGM (Award of Garden Merit)

Tolmiea menziesii 'Taff's Gold' (Pick-a-back plant 'Taff's Gold') will reach a height of 0.45m and a spread of 0.6m after 2-5 years.

Suggested uses: Banks and Slopes, Beds and borders, City, Conservatory, Containers, Cottage/Informal, Edging, Foliage only, Garden edging, Ground Cover, Indoor, Low Maintenance, Underplanting, Woodland

Cultivation: Plant in moisture-retentive, free draining soil in full or partial shade. Also grown as a houseplant for its interesting plantlets.
